联考3day1总结

来源:互联网 发布:onps暑校 知乎 编辑:程序博客网 时间:2024/05/01 04:56

做题过程

因为先做了day2,所以对题目难度大致有点把握。看完题,T1做法比较好想,就先打了T1。
T2,反复读了几遍题,注意到食物可以拆开运输,又看到那两个小于等于50000的数据范围,就想到用背包,将普通的背包下标和值交换下就行了。然后就是怎么处理多重背包的问题。以前做过一次取模后用单调队列的,但一时没想起来,想起来的是将每种拆成1,2,4,8……个的方法。
码完拍完前两题,剩下的时间都用在T3上。没想到什么好方法,推公式也推不出来。对于这种概率期望题我还是不熟啊。

结果

100+100+0
第二题虽然多了个log,但开了O2是能过的(毕竟只是log2100)。

总结

不该丢的分不能丢,就算简单也要检查、对拍。
讲题时听富榄T3的做法,感觉很简单,实现起来也不难。关键是考时没找到这道题的本质,没想公式可以由一般情况推到特殊情况,这种类型的题还要多练练。

0 0
原创粉丝点击